The Dream Oppressive slumber, wicked cold and stark, Domain of heartless imps of evil schemes. Please rescue me from nightmares of the dark, And banish every ghost of restless dreams. Transport me to that place where lovers dwell, Enveloped in a shroud of perfect peace, Where sorrows of a saddened sleep dispel, And aches of love that’s lost must surely cease. Your words must push unfounded fears aside, As feelings strive to conquer intellect. To comfort and to stem the rushing tide, Of poignant pains, destructive and direct. Declare your love unwavering and true, And ease this racing heart that pines for you. |
